Adherence to Vietnam’s QCVN 06:2022/BXD Fire Safety Regulations for Vinh
Compliance with QCVN 06:2022/BXD is mandatory for all building projects in Vinh, particularly for high-occupancy structures such as apartment complexes and office towers. This regulation categorizes buildings by fire hazard levels and specifies the required fire resistance ratings for structural and non-structural elements. Antifires’ fire-rated glazing systems are engineered to meet these classifications, offering EI 60 and EI 90 performance levels that ensure both integrity and thermal insulation. The glazed assemblies are constructed with multi-layer glass compositions, incorporating intumescent gel interlayers that expand under heat to form a protective barrier. This mechanism prevents flame penetration and limits temperature rise on the unexposed side, complying with the insulation criteria of ≤140°C average rise and ≤180°C maximum rise. The framing systems utilize G.M.S. hollow steel sections, fitted with ceramic wool and intumescent seals to maintain a continuous fire-resistant envelope. For Vinh’s commercial and residential projects, these systems are installed in critical locations such as stairwell enclosures, corridor partitions, and lobby facades. By adhering to the localized regulations and providing certified test documentation, Antifires enables developers to secure building permits and pass fire safety inspections efficiently. The integration of these products supports safe egress and compartmentation, which are fundamental to the fire safety strategy outlined in QCVN 06:2022/BXD.
Selecting EI 60 and EI 90 Fire Rated Glass for Vinh’s Tropical Climate Conditions
The tropical climate of Vinh, characterized by high humidity levels and significant temperature fluctuations, presents unique challenges for fire-rated glazing systems. Antifires recommends EI 60 and EI 90 rated glass products that are specifically designed to withstand these environmental conditions without compromising fire performance. The glass units feature intumescent interlayers that remain optically clear under normal conditions, ensuring natural light transmission for building interiors. During a fire event, these interlayers activate at elevated temperatures, expanding to create an opaque insulating barrier that resists thermal shock—a critical factor in Vinh’s coastal environment where rapid temperature changes can occur. The multi-layer construction, such as the 28mm EI60 panel (6mm + 5.5mm gel + 5mm + 5.5mm gel + 6mm), provides robust structural stability. The sealed edges and ceramic fiber expansion gaps (3mm–5mm) accommodate thermal movement while maintaining the fire seal. For projects near the coast, where salt-laden air can accelerate corrosion, the frames are treated with protective coatings. This localized engineering ensures long-term durability and consistent fire performance, making these systems ideal for Vinh’s residential towers, schools, and government buildings. The products are tested under controlled conditions that simulate real-world fire scenarios, providing verified data on integrity and insulation performance over the required duration.
Fire Protection Demands in Vinh’s Hotel, Hospital, and Mixed-Use Developments
Vinh’s expanding hospitality sector, particularly hotels and mixed-use developments near Vinh International Airport and the central business district, demands robust fire protection solutions for high-occupancy environments. Antifires supplies fire-rated windows, doors, and partition systems that support 60-minute to 120-minute fire resistance, tailored to the specific needs of these buildings. In hotel stairwells and lobbies, where large glazed areas are often required for aesthetics and wayfinding, the glazing must provide reliable compartmentation to prevent smoke and flame spread. The systems are designed to maintain structural integrity under furnace pressure conditions (0 ±2Pa), with maximum deflection controlled to ensure the glass remains within the frame. For hospital applications, where patient evacuation is complex, the EI 60 and EI 90 ratings provide critical time for emergency response. The glass assemblies incorporate intumescent seals (20mm × 4mm) and ceramic wool packing to block gaps, meeting the stringent requirements of BS EN 1364-1 and AS1530.4. These systems are installed using M6/M8 anchor bolts at 300–600mm spacing, ensuring secure attachment to the building structure. By integrating these certified fire-rated solutions, developers in Vinh can achieve the necessary fire safety ratings while maintaining open, light-filled spaces that enhance the occupant experience. Antifires provides detailed installation specifications and compliance documentation to support project approvals.
